After School Ministry

Our After School Program is offered free of charge to the neighborhood and provides a safe space for an average of  40 children, grades kindergarten through 8th, every year.  Within this program we offer homework tutoring, arts and crafts time, yoga and dance classes, Peacemakers Tae Kwon Do, as well as a gardening club!

 

Summer Camp Ministry

Summer Camp, another program offered free of charge, is offered every summer to youth, grades K-8th, for 5 or 6 weeks. Children spend 3 days a week at the church participating in art & crafts, music club, games, and Bible study. The last two years, thanks to strong donor support, we have been able to have a carnival day to wrap up camp, with a waterslide, face painting, games and snacks!


Children’s Gardening Club

Our Children’s Garden Summer Class provides two months of garden education programming for neighborhood children, ranging in age from 5 to 12 years old.  The daily classes incorporate garden care, arts and crafts, and lessons on nutrition and sustainability. They explore a variety of topics, including how growing food can help us care for our bodies, the Earth, and our community. The children get the satisfaction of  seeing their garden blossom under their care and get to eat the literal fruits of their labor.
